Night of the Yokai: A Sunset Spirit Parade 🏮Presented by Fort Wayne Sister Cities, Takaoka Committee, and the Japanese American Association of Indiana.
As the sun dips below the horizon this Fright Night, the boundary between our world and the spirit realm grows thin. Join the FWSCI Takaoka Committee and the JAAI for a celebration of Japanese folklore like no other!
We’re bringing the legendary Yokai—the mischievous, mysterious, and occasionally spooky spirits of Japan—to the streets of Fort Wayne. Whether you’re a fan of the clever Kitsune, the formidable Tengu, or the water-dwelling Kappa, this is your night to let your inner spirit roam free.
• When: Saturday, October 17th
• Meet & Greet: 6:00 PM (Come show off your masks and costumes!)
• Parade Start: 7:00 PM (Sharp at sunset)
Don your best Japanese-inspired folklore attire and walk with us as we celebrate our Sister City connection with Takaoka in the most spirited way possible.
